## Changelog — LockerLoop v2.4

Quick one for the sync: the laundry-locker access flow now skips the double-PIN prompt when a resident badge-taps within 30 seconds of reserving. Fixed the ghost-reservation bug where lockers at the Marlowe Yard site stayed "occupied" after pickup. Rollout is at 40%, full by Friday. Questions or rollback requests go to the flow owner, named below.

named custodian: Oliath Ralax

**Mgmt Meeting Minutes — Retiring the Brightline Range**

Quick recap for sales leads at Fenholt Supplies: we agreed to retire the Brightline fixture range by year-end. Remaining stock moves to clearance pricing next month, and accounts on standing orders get migrated to the Lumetta range. Trade-in incentives were approved in principle. The confidential note on next steps sits just below.

board note of bajof-bajeg: The pricing group signed off on a budget of $13.4 million for Project Sildor. The renewal with Lamixek Holdings closes at $48.9 million a year, 49 percent above the last contract.

// Support note: MAX_AUDIT_ROWS caps the Ledgerpane viewer at one
// page fetch. Raising it past 500 causes browser stalls on older
// tenant datasets — don't bump it for ticket workarounds; use the
// export job instead. If a customer hits the cap, file it upstream
// and attach the build token shown on the next line.

session token of kageg-tahop = htk14_af3c1ccccb7dcf